BRUSSELS (Reuters) -The European Union will not renew sanctions against three men targeted over Russia's war against Ukraine when the current punitive measures expire later this week, three diplomatic sources told Reuters on Tuesday. Western governments have imposed sweeping economic sanctions, including Russian oil import bans, on Moscow for its invasion of Ukraine in February last year. The trio are Russian businessman Grigory Berezkin, billionaire Farkhad Akhmedov and the former head of Ozon, a Russian e-commerce firm, Alexander Shulgin.
